In graphing the equation y&lt;2x -5, the line is dotted and shaded below the line drawn.
MakcuM [25]

Answer:

True.

Step-by-step explanation:

This is  'less than' so the area below the line is shaded.

It is a dotted line  because the solution does not contain points on the line as the inequality sign is < NOT ≤.
